May the God of hope fill you with all joy and peace as you trust in him, so that you may overflow with hope by the power of the Holy Spirit.

Romans 15:13 NIV

Key Thought​


Rather than having much commentary on this beautiful blessing, let's share the joy of this blessing and the confidence of our hope with those we love! May this blessing be for all of you. May hope be yours because of the precious gift of the Holy Spirit within you!

Today's Prayer​


O Father, I thank you for living hope — the hope that I have because of my living Savior who conquered death and because of the living presence of the Holy Spirit within me assuring me that I will share in glory with you. I thank you that my hope is not just a wish for something in the future, but that it comes with the deep assurance that what I hope for will happen. Thank you, in Jesus' name. Amen.
